Synchrotron‐radiation X‐ray diffraction studies of CaF 2 at high pressures have been performed on a powder sample up to 45 GPa and on a single‐crystal sample up to 9.4 GPa. The bulk modulus of the low‐pressure phase was determined to be B 0 = 87 (5) GPa. A phase transition was observed at about 9.5 GPa. The transition is accompanied by a volume contraction of 11%. The high‐pressure phase is orthorhombic PbCl 2 type (space group Pbnm ). The sample only partially reverts to the low‐pressure phase upon release of pressure.
